Objective

  • Complete compatibility with CSS Module 4

Solution

  • Added Oklcha which implements the Oklch color model.
  • Updated Color and LegacyColor accordingly.

Migration Guide

  • Convert Oklcha to Oklaba using the provided From implementations and then handle accordingly.

Notes

This is the last color space missing from the CSS Module 4 standard, and is also the one I believe we should recommend users actually work with for hand-crafting colours. It has all the uniformity benefits of Oklab combined with the intuition chroma and hue provide (when compared to a-axis and b-axis parameters).
